The Virginia circuit court system is composed of 31 judicial circuits with 120 separate circuit courts in the various counties and cities of the Commonwealth. The circuit court is the trial court with the broadest powers in Virginia and handles all civil cases with claims of more than $25,000. The general district court handles traffic violations, hears minor criminal cases known as misdemeanors, and conducts preliminary hearings for more serious criminal cases called felonies. The Supreme Court of Virginia is the highest court in the Commonwealth of Virginia. Virginia’s court of last resort, the Supreme Court of Virginia reviews decisions of the circuit courts and the Court of Appeals when such appeals have been allowed, decisions from the State Corporation Commission, and certain disciplinary actions of the Virginia State Bar regarding attorneys.
